Making the Sauce
- Steam or boil the lobster for 5–7 minutes until shells are bright red.
- Remove the lobster tails, let cool, then chop the meat into bite-sized pieces.
- Melt the butter in a skillet over medium heat and sauté minced shallot or garlic for 2–3 minutes.
- Add heavy cream and lobster broth, simmer for 5–7 minutes until thick.
- Stir in Worcestershire sauce, mustard, salt, and pepper; simmer for an additional 2–3 minutes.
- Fold in the lobster meat and cook on low heat for another 2–3 minutes.
- Squeeze in lemon juice and garnish with tarragon before serving.
